▌08/12/2024

Greece is bracing for a bout of severe weather as strong storms and hail are forecasted to hit various regions of the country. The Hellenic National Meteorological Service (EMY) has issued an updated weather warning, indicating that these conditions will persist throughout the day.

The affected areas include the islands of the Ionian Sea, Epirus, and the western mainland regions such as Western Sterea and the Western Peloponnese. Also, significant weather events are anticipated in Thrace, the islands of the eastern Aegean, particularly around Samos and Ikaria, and potentially the Dodecanese islands.

Reports suggest that the storms will be accompanied by frequent lightning and localized hail. The EMY cautions that heavy rainfall and thunderstorms could lead to flash flooding and transport disruptions, advising residents to stay alert and limit unnecessary travel.

Over the past days, emergency alerts were sent to mobile phones in areas like Ilia, urging locals to minimize movement due to intense rainfalls. The authorities have emphasized the importance of following official advice to ensure safety.

Visibility concerns are expected during morning and evening hours with fog likely to reduce visibility in parts of the country. Meanwhile, southern and southwesterly winds are predicted to reach speeds between 4 and 7 on the Beaufort scale, particularly affecting maritime and coastal areas.

Temperatures are set to fluctuate, with the northern regions experiencing highs of 13 to 15 degrees Celsius, while other regions might witness temperatures rising up to 18 degrees Celsius. In the south, some areas might reach even higher temperatures between 19 and 21 degrees Celsius.

In Athens and Thessaloniki, periods of cloudiness with potential showers and isolated thunderstorms are anticipated by the evening. Wind speeds in these urban areas will vary between 3 and 4 Beaufort, picking up later in the day.

The EMY forecasts that the adverse weather patterns will gradually ease off as we head into the week, though vigilance is highly advised until storm conditions subside fully.
